We Come, O Christ, to You

Author: Margaret Clarkson Meter: 6.6.6.6.8.8 Appears in 18 hymnals Scripture: Colossians 1:17 Lyrics: 1 We come, O Christ, to you, true Son of God and man, by whom all things consist, in whom all life began. In you alone we live and move and have our being in your love. 2 You are the way to God, your blood our ransom paid; in you we face our Judge and Maker unafraid. Before the throne absolved we stand; your love has met your law's demand. 3 You are the living truth; all wisdom dwells in you, the source of every skill, the one eternal True! O great I AM! in you we rest, sure answer to our every quest. 4 You only are true life to know you is to live the more abundant life that earth can never give. O risen Lord! we live in you: in us each day your life renew! 5 We worship you, Lord Christ, our Savior and our King; to you our youth and strength adoringly we bring: so fill our hearts that all may view your life in us and turn to you! Topics: King, God/Christ as; Love God's Love to Us; Opening of Worship; Creation; King, God/Christ as; Love God's Love to Us; Opening of Worship; Redemption; Wisdom Used With Tune: EASTVIEW

Christ the Lord Is Risen Today

Author: Wipo of Burgundy, d.1048; Jane E. Leeson, 1809-1881 Meter: 7.7.7.7 D Appears in 87 hymnals Scripture: Colossians 1:18 First Line: Christ the Lord is ris'n today Lyrics: 1 Christ the Lord is ris'n today; Christians, haste your vows to pay; Make your joy and praises known At the Paschal Victim's throne. For the sheep the Lamb has bled, Sinless in the sinner's stead. Christ the Lord is ris'n on high; Now he lives, no more to die. 2 Christ, the Victim undefiled, God and sinners reconciled, When in fierce and bloody strife Met together death and life. Christians, on this happy day Raise your hearts with joy and say: "Christ the Lord is ris'n on high; Now he lives, no more to die." 3 Say, O wond'ring Mary, say What you saw along your way. "I beheld the glory bright Of the risen Lord of light, Empty tomb and angels seen Where Christ's body once had been. Christ my hope, raised gloriously, Makes his way to Galilee." 4 Christ, who once for sinners bled, Now the first-born from the dead, Throned in endless might and pow'r, Lives and reigns for evermore. Hail, eternal Hope on high! Hail, O King of victory! Hail, our Prince of life adored! Show us mercy, gracious Lord. Topics: Easter Vigil ; Easter Season Resurrection; Faith; Jesus Christ; Joy; Lamb of God; Paschal Mystery; Praise; Reconciliation, Atonement, Forgiveness; Redemption; Struggle; Thanksgiving, Gratitude; Victory over Sin and Death; Worship and Adoration Used With Tune: VICTIMAE PASCHALI Text Sources: Victimae paschali laudes
